BASSETERRE, St. Kitts, November 18, 2023 (SKNIS) – From Saturday, November 18 to Saturday, November 25, the Ministry of Agriculture, Fisheries, Marine Resources and Cooperatives will be hosting a week of activities in observance of World Fisheries Day 2023. World Fisheries Day is celebrated globally on November 21 annually. The activities organized during the week of celebration in St. Kitts and Nevis will seek to amply the ministry’s mission to achieve CARICOM’s 25 by 2025 Agenda of significantly reducing the region’s food import bill to 25 percent by the year 2025. Basseterre, St. Kitts, November 17, 2023 (SKNBS): The St. Kitts and Nevis Bureau of Standards (SKNBS) is actively developing a National Vehicle Inspection Standard geared toward ensuring the roadworthiness of vehicles. This standard aims to streamline and unify the vehicle inspection process across the twin-island federation. As part of this initiative, two experienced vehicle inspectors, Mr. Derval Phipps from St. Kitts and Mr. Franchette Manners from Nevis, who also serve on the Bureau’s technical committee, were dispatched to Tokyo, Japan. Basseterre, St. Kitts, November 17, 2023 (SKNBS): The St. Kitts and Nevis Bureau of Standards (SKNBS) has introduced three new technical regulations, recently published in the Gazette, aimed at bringing about positive changes in the dynamics of product transactions within the nation. Basseterre, St. Kitts, November 17, 2023 (SKNBS): In a significant move toward ensuring vehicle safety and consumer protection, EAA Ltd is set to visit the Federation in 2024. Their mission involves conducting a comprehensive needs assessment at all vehicle inspection facilities within the Federation. Inspection shops meeting minimum requirements will be equipped with base equipment to ensure vehicles are inspected at a standardized level locally.EAA Ltd is a globally recognized firm that possesses substantial knowledge in the field of motor vehicle inspection.
